Why Should You Consider Music as a Career?

music as career

Have you ever considered turning your passion for music into a full-fledged career? If so, you’re in the right place. We’re here to explore the incredible benefits of choosing music as a career path. From personal fulfillment to financial opportunities, the world of music has so much to offer. Let’s dive in!

1. Personal Fulfillment: Doing What You Love

Hey, who doesn’t want to do what they love? If music is your passion, turning it into a career means you get to spend your days immersed in what you love most. You’ll be playing, learning, and performing, and that’s a dream come true for many. It’s like turning your hobby into your job!

A. Passion into Profession

Imagine waking up every day to do what you love. Music is not just a hobby; it’s a way of life. Turning your passion into a profession means living a life filled with creativity and joy.

B. Emotional Connection

Music connects with the soul. As a musician, you have the power to touch people’s hearts and make a lasting impact. It’s a feeling like no other.

2. Flexibility: Be Your Own Boss

A. Choose Your Path

Want to be the captain of your ship? Want to tour the world or teach music? The choice is yours. A music career often means you can run your teaching business, set your hours, and work from home. You can also explore different roles like session musician or band member. It’s all about what suits you best! Music offers a wide range of career paths, from performing to producing.

B. Set Your Schedule

Say goodbye to the 9-to-5 grind. As a musician, you have the flexibility to set your own schedule and work when it suits you best.

3. Financial Opportunities: Make Money from Your Talent

Think all musicians are starving artists? Think again! you can make over $60,000 per year on average. Plus, there are various career paths like music therapy, management, or technology that might pay even better.

A. Multiple Revenue Streams

From gigs to streaming royalties, the opportunities to make money are endless. You can even sell merchandise or offer online classes.
